ketchums / php-case-converter
v2.0.0
2021-04-18 01:16 UTC
Requires
- php: >=7.4
Requires (Dev)
- phpunit/phpunit: ^9
This package is auto-updated.
Last update: 2024-09-19 23:02:42 UTC
README
php-case-converter 是一个库,用于将字符串转换为其他类型的大小写。
要求
- PHP >= 7.4
安装
使用 composer 安装
composer require ketchums/php-case-converter
问题
可以在 Github Issue Tracker 上提交错误报告和功能请求。
贡献
有关信息,请参阅 CONTRIBUTING.md。
版本控制
php-case-converter 使用 MAJOR.MINOR.PATCH
版本号格式。
示例
基本
use App\CaseDetector;
use App\CaseConverter;
$string = 'some.cool.string';
$detector = new CaseDetector();
$converter = new CaseConverter($string, $detector->detectType($string));
echo $converter->toPascalCase(); // someCoolString
echo $converter->toKebabCase(); // some-cool-string
不喜欢魔法方法?
echo $caseConvert->toCase('pascal'); // someCoolString
echo $caseConvert->toCase('kebab'); // some-cool-string
让包为您检测类型
use App\CaseDetector;
use App\CaseConverter;
$converter = new CaseConverter($string);